Lets stir the pot and say that the Hyosung GT125 has a more robust and heavier built air cooled motor that could arguably take far more boost from forced induction than a fragile 30bhp+ 2stroke motor that has small light components and no extra designed in strength.

I mean people say your lucky to get more than about 5000miles out of a Mito engine with a 150-160cc big bore kit, so putting on a blower as well? Maybe he's already brought a big dustpan and brush?
